Understanding Licensing and Regulation

One of the most crucial aspects of selecting an online casino is verifying its licensing and regulatory status. A legitimate online casino will operate under a license issued by a reputable jurisdiction, demonstrating its commitment to fair play and responsible gaming practices. These jurisdictions often include the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Kahnawake Gaming Commission. These bodies impose strict standards on operators, requiring them to adhere to rigorous testing procedures and ongoing audits. Without a valid license, an online casino operates in a grey area, potentially exposing players to risks of fraud, unfair games, and delayed payouts.

The significance of licensing extends beyond simply avoiding fraudulent operations. It also provides a framework for dispute resolution. Should a player encounter a problem with an online casino – be it a payment issue or a disagreement over bonus terms – they can lodge a complaint with the licensing authority. The authority will then investigate the matter and mediate a resolution. Different licenses offer different levels of player protection, so it's worth researching the specific requirements of the jurisdiction where the casino is licensed. For example, the UK Gambling Commission is known for its particularly stringent regulations, offering a high degree of security for players.

Importance of Independent Auditing

Licensing isn’t enough on its own. Reputable online casinos also undergo independent auditing by third-party organizations such as eCOGRA, iTech Labs, and GLI. These audits verify the fairness and randomness of the casino's games, ensuring that the results are not manipulated in any way. Auditors use sophisticated mathematical algorithms to test the random number generators (RNGs) employed by the casino, confirming they produce truly random outcomes. The results of these audits are typically published on the casino's website, providing transparency and accountability. A seal of approval from a respected auditing organization is a strong indicator of a trustworthy online casino.

Furthermore, many auditing bodies also assess the casino's security measures, including its data encryption protocols and fraud prevention systems. This ensures that players' personal and financial information is protected from unauthorized access. Regular audits are essential, as online security threats are constantly evolving. A casino that takes its security seriously will invest in ongoing audits to stay ahead of potential risks.

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are a common condition of online casino bonuses. They are designed to prevent players from simply depositing a small amount of money, claiming a bonus, and immediately withdrawing the winnings. Calculating wagering requirements can sometimes be complex. For instance, if a casino offers a 100% deposit match bonus up to $200 with a 30x wagering requirement, and a player deposits $100, they will receive a $100 bonus. The total amount that must be wagered is then $3000 (30 x $100).

Different games contribute differently to the fulfillment of w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ning that the full amount of your bet counts towards the requirement. However, table games like blackjack and roulette may only contribute a smaller percentage, such as 10% or 20%. It’s important to check the casino’s terms and conditions to understand the contribution rates for different games. Responsible Gaming and Secure Transactions

Responsible gaming is a crucial aspect of enjoying online casinos. Operators should provide t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, wagering limits, self-exclusion options, and links to responsible gambling organizations. The ability to set limits on your spending and playing time is essential for maintaining control.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from the casino for a specified period.

Secure transactions are also vital. Online casinos should employ state-of-the-art security measures to protect players' financial information. This includes using SSL encryption to encrypt all data transmitted between the player’s computer and the casino’s servers. Reputable casinos also offer a variety of secure pay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. It’s crucial to choose a payment method that you trust and that offers adequate security features. Furthermore, verifying the casino's security certifications and privacy policy provides further assurance.
